The impedance of this antenna is around 300 Ω, so you may want to use a transformer or a λ/4 long piece of 120 Ω coaxial cable to match this impedance to 50 Ω. To optimize the antenna for a frequency RANGE, do the calculations twice, once for the low end of the range and once for the high end; then average the two and plan to adjust the VSWR on both ends of the range as needed.
